Transaction 95a1396652bd640c13ba20a7f583c39cf200b55af6e0ef06d0accc2f4d1cc38a
1 Input
1 Output
-
95a1396652bd640c13ba20a7f583c39cf200b55af6e0ef06d0accc2f4d1cc38a:0
- value
- 58336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2bdd4c0e24ce49b24da9e904fb133dbd266a6b73 OP_EQUAL
- address
- 35gx5nRGCyFnTxZdrZb9RAR2WsAJVc9f9B